Detailed insights for SL6 3QU

Overview

Postcode SL6 3QU is located in a rural hamlet, within the Hurley & Walthams ward of Windsor and Maidenhead in the South East region, and forms part of the Cookham & Waltham area. It has moderate de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 30.3 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income of residents in Cookham & Waltham is £64,600 per year. The nearest station is Maidenhead located about 3.0 miles away. There are 2 primary and no secondary schools in the area.

Property prices in Hurley & Walthams

Based on 63 recent sales, the median property price is £800,000 in Hurley & Walthams area, with individual transactions ranging from £170,000 up to £3,723,425.
